The Korena take

Washburn’s Victorian is a right-handed parlor acoustic built around a laminate spruce top and Trembesi back and sides. Its warm, balanced voice is presented for delicate fingerpicking and light strumming, while the mahogany Soft V neck and ebony fingerboard give the guitar a vintage-leaning playing feel. The compact parlor format keeps the focus on intimate playing, and Victorian-style details—including rope purfling, herringbone accents, and an antique-brown matte finish—give it a distinctly period-inspired appearance. A gig bag is included for transport.
